Understanding Funeral Costs:

First, let’s understand what contributes to funeral costs. These expenses vary widely depending on several factors:

* Type of service: A simple cremation is generally more affordable than a traditional burial with embalming, viewing, and a formal ceremony.
* Casket selection: Caskets range in price from basic models to elaborate designs, impacting overall cost significantly.
* Other services: Transportation, obituary notices, flowers, clergy fees, and memorial keepsakes all add to the final bill.

Ways Funeral Homes Can Help with Financing:

While funeral homes don’t usually extend credit directly, they can assist in several ways:

* Payment Plans: Many funeral homes offer flexible payment plans, allowing families to spread out the cost over a set period. This can make managing expenses more manageable.
* Pre-Need Arrangements: Planning ahead is a wise move. Pre-need arrangements allow individuals to pre-pay for their funeral, locking in prices and relieving their loved ones of financial stress during an already difficult time.

* Connections with Third-Party Financiers: Funeral homes often have relationships with third-party financing companies specializing in funeral expenses. These companies offer loans specifically designed to cover funeral costs, potentially with lower interest rates than traditional personal loans.
* Guidance on Financial Assistance Programs: Some funeral homes are aware of government programs or charitable organizations that offer financial assistance for funeral expenses. They can help connect families with these resources.

Understanding Headstone Costs:

Headstones come in various styles, materials, and sizes, which significantly impacts their price. Simple granite markers may start around $500, while elaborate monuments with intricate carvings can cost several thousand dollars.

Factors influencing headstone costs include:

* Material: Granite is the most common choice due to its durability, but marble, bronze, and even wood are options.
* Size and Shape: Larger headstones with unique designs naturally cost more than smaller, simpler ones.
* Engravings: Adding names, dates, epitaphs, and images increases the price.

Financing Options for Your Loved One’s Memorial:

1. Savings: The most straightforward approach is to save up for the headstone beforehand. This allows you to choose the perfect memorial without financial strain.

2. Payment Plans: Many monument companies offer payment plans, allowing you to spread the cost over several months or even years. Discuss available options with your chosen provider.

3. Funeral Insurance: Some funeral insurance policies cover expenses like headstones. Review your existing policy or consider purchasing one specifically for final expenses, including memorialization costs.

4. Personal Loans: Banks and credit unions offer personal loans that can be used for various purposes, including headstone purchases. Compare interest rates and terms from different lenders to find the best option.

5. Crowdfunding: Platforms like GoFundMe or Fundly allow you to share your story and request contributions from friends and family who want to help honor your loved one’s memory.

6. Community Organizations: Check with local churches, fraternal organizations, or veterans’ groups as they sometimes offer financial assistance for funeral expenses, including headstones.
